Because Airbnb headquater is in US, so I think the US site will contain the most of the properties.
Another question, it seems that one login can be used in all Airbnb subsites, such as airbnb.co.in, airbnb.ie, airbnb.com, etc. Is that correct?
Hello @Chongwei0
Whether you log into airbnb.com or airbnb.co.in you will find the same number of listings on both sites. The order in which you see them will change as the algorithm changes each time you log in.
And yes, you use the same login if you decide to go onto the different Airbnb country sites.
